What is this piece called near the steering column?

I'd like to know what this empty area is called because I want to put like a flag/sticker or emblem in that area. I've seen it before on the forums but don't know what that dumb empty spot is called.

Thats where the HUD controls go on the 2LT & 2SS models, you want to check out Emblempros site they sell dash plaques that go there.
